
c/c++
black_hidden
这个作者很懒,什么都没留下…
展开
-
C++中的算术类型
1、算术类型分为两类:整型(包括字符和布尔类型)和浮点型。 2、布尔类型(bool):取值是真或假。 3、字符类型(char):一个char的空间应确保可以存放机器基本字符集中任意字符对应的数字值,即一个char的大小和一个机器字节一样(8位)。 4、短整型(short):16位 5、整型(int):16位 6、长整型(long);32位 7、长整型(long long):64位原创 2016-09-13 09:36:51 · 1347 阅读 · 0 评论 -
for循环和while循环优缺点
在for循环中,循环控制变量的初始化和修改都放在循环头部分,形式较简洁,且特别适用于循环次数已知的情况。 在while循环中,循环控制变量的初始化一般放在while语句之前,循环控制变量的修改一般放在循环体中,形式上不如for语句简洁,但它比较适于循环次数不易预知的情况(用某一条件控制循环)。 两种形式各有优点,但它们在功能上是等价的,可以互相转换。转载 2016-09-12 17:27:28 · 2242 阅读 · 0 评论 -
C++中前置递增运算符和后置递增运算符的区别
首先,这两种运算符都必须作用于左值运算对象。但前置版本将对象本身作为左值返回,后置版本将对象原始值的副本作为右值返回。 例1、 int i=0,j; j=++i; 得到 j=1,i=1. int i=0,j; j=i++; 得到j=0,i=1。 例2、 *a++等价于*(a++),其中解引用运算符对象是a未增加之前的值,最终该语句输出a开始时指向的那个元素,并将指针向前原创 2016-09-16 10:22:54 · 2314 阅读 · 0 评论